How to Evaluate Unknown Terms Like This
Whether you’re a content creator, parent, researcher, or casual browser, encountering unfamiliar terms is now commonplace. Here’s a structured approach to evaluating them:
Step 1: Check for Context
Look for:
- Where the term appears (e.g., product listing, forum post, question forum)
- Any descriptive text surrounding it
- Whether it’s linked to a product, service, or concept
Terms without context are unlikely to represent real-world concepts.
Step 2: Search for Credible References
Use reputable sources:
- Government or regulatory databases
- Academic or scientific publications
- Recognized industry directories
- Established media outlets
If a term has no presence in credible sources, treat it with caution.
Step 3: Look for Patterns
Try to see:
- Is it referenced in multiple places?
- Does it appear with other keywords?
- Is there a pattern in how it’s being used?
Patterns often reveal intent — whether SEO manipulation, product branding, or another purpose.
Step 4: Ask Experts
If a term appears related to a technical or specialized domain (e.g., medical, legal, scientific), reach out to professionals in that field.
Experts can:
- Explain whether the term has meaning
- Confirm if it’s relevant to the domain
- Offer insight into unusual terminology
